Pastors Nick and Dorothy Mounts are the founders of Over- look Ministries. The couple was called into full-time street ministry in 1993 in Dayton, Ohio. Tragedy struck in 1996 when they lost their beloved son, who was part of their ministry, to a drunk driver. After a time of mourning, and in coping with their loss, they moved to FL and received a renewed passion and vision for ministering to the overlooked. Offering support to those whom society, but not God, has given up on, they provide spiritual parenting, a spiritual family, and guidance to those who have nowhere to turn. Since 1998 they have been faith- fully serving Brevard County. With the help of the Overlook Ministries Board, the support of caring community partners, and to the glory of God, their ministry mission is expanding. We are excited for God to expand our territory in 2020 as we break ground increase our current facility from a 6 bed dorm to a 20 bed dorm with many other updates to the building and grounds. Overlook’s Bible Training Center program is a year-long, intensive Bible training

experience for men. With a focus on the practical application of The Word of God

and Christian living principles, men learn in an atmosphere of love and direction,

we call “direction with affection”. This program is designed to work when every-

thing else has failed. Our goal is to save the lives of desperate men living in crisis

by helping them to “get life right” through a living relationship with God, knowing

Jesus as Lord and Savior, in an environment of love. As a result, these men learn

the skills needed to live a life of power and purpose. It is our vision to see broken

men healed by the powerful Word of God, our heart to help men to learn to help

themselves, and our passion is to teach them how to “get life right”. Our program

purpose is to offer spiritual, physical, emotional and social support for men in crisis

due to life-controlling behaviors. Men are accepted into the program free of cost.

This allows them to break free of their unique behaviors. Our program serves men,

18 years or older, of all faiths. When all else fails, this program works. Men are set

free to serve The King!

STEPPIN UP Monday at 6:30 pm

Avenue Worship Center 85 Richland Ave, Merritt Island, FL

This program offers men and women who are struggling with life-controlling

behaviors, an opportunity to come together for a shared meal, worship and

Bible Study. The messages are focused on practical application of the Word

of God to provide Biblical coping skills that attendees can apply to their daily

lives. The buffet style, sit down meal provides a comfortable and welcoming

environment of fellowship and grace.

ON THE STREETS Saturday at 2:00 pm

300 N. US HWY 1, Cocoa FL

Our on the streets ministry offers the Word of God to those living in the streets, park or wooded areas though the offering of a good hot meal in a consistent place, at a consistent time. Volunteers help prepare hot meals and our Pastors, director, or one of the men in the OBTC program give a message of hope from the Word of God.
